Dr. Chanchai Sirikasemlert is the Executive Director of the Thailand Textile Institute, bringing expertise in textile innovation, quality assurance, and industry standards. With a Ph.D. in Textiles from Hong Kong Polytechnic University, Dr. Chanchai has led initiatives in textile processing and testing, previously serving as Director of Technology Promotion at the Institute. His experience includes quality management at Intertek Testing Services and expertise in Oeko-Tex and ISO standards. Dr. Chanchai’s leadership fosters growth and innovation in Thailand’s textile industry through strategic research, consulting, and international partnerships.

Mr. Niwat Lersnimitthum serves as Chairman of the Thai Nonwoven Fabrics Industry Trade Association and Vice Chairman of the Textile Industry Club within the Federation of Thai Industries. He is the Director and Managing Director of Tietex Asia, Ltd., a position he has held since 1996. With a strong background in industrial engineering. His extensive experience and leadership continue to drive advancements in Thailand's textile and nonwoven sectors.

Mr. Socrates Ng finished his high school years in Hong Kong La Salle College.
He was a Soccer Team Captain. Later on, he went to further his study in the US and graduated from the University of Southern California (USC) with a Bachelor Degree in International Finance in 1993. Socrates has been in the Non Woven industry since 1993, and specialized in needle punching felt. Over the years, he has developed several innovative products and had been granted with international patents. Since 2005, he has become the Managing Director of Fairtech Holding Limited. In 2017, Mr Socrates Ng was elected the President of Hong Kong Non Woven Association (HKNA).

Kanav Gupta is currently working as the Associate Director at BCH a consulting services company, dedicated to the Nonwovens and Technical Textiles Industry of India. He has worked in Ernst and Young and KPMG in areas of Telecom and Outsourcing, and Robotics in the past. Since last 5 years he has been working at BCH in areas of Market Research, Business Development and New Project setup in the Absorbent Hygiene, Nonwovens and Technical textiles industry. He has a global experience by working with companies from Asia, Europe and the Americas. BCH Further organises various industry events and runs India’s oldest dedicated Technical textiles and Nonwovens magazine – Tech Tex India.

Dr. Raksit Supthanyakul is Division Manager of Marketing Technical Service at PTT MCC Biochem, where he leads product innovation, application development, and technical collaborations across flexible packaging, extrusion coating, compound & injection, and fiber & nonwoven on a global scale. With a strong academic foundation, holding a B.Sc. in Agro-Industry from Kasetsart University and a Ph.D. in Polymer Science from the Petroleum and Petrochemical College at Chulalongkorn University, he has been a driving force behind advancing BioPBS into high-performance, sustainable applications, particularly in food packaging. Known for connecting science and industry, Dr. Raksit builds strong relationships with converters and brand owners worldwide, strengthening supply chains and creating new opportunities for compostable products.

Dr. Jatesuda Jirawutthiwongchai is the Product Innovation Manager at SMS Corporation,
where she leads research teams in starch modification and industrial applications,
including bioplastics, adhesives, construction, paper, and textiles. Under her leadership,
tapioca starch is transformed into high-value products through innovative research and
the dedication of her team.
Dr. Jatesuda holds a Bachelor's degree in Agro-Industry from Kasetsart University,
Thailand, and a Ph.D. in Polymer Science from the Petroleum and Petrochemical College
at Chulalongkorn University, Thailand. She has made significant contributions to the
R&D teams at Siam Modified Starch and SMS Corporation, driving for ward
advancements in the industrial use of starch.
